PART 3 Measures following confirmation of disease

Presence of the disease in wild animals and declaration of a wild animal infected zone40

1

The National Assembly must, on confirmation of the disease in any wild animal in Wales, declare a wild animal infected zone in Wales.

2

The National Assembly may, if it is satisfied that disease is present in a wild animal in England or Scotland, declare a wild animal infected zone in Wales.

3

A wild animal infected zone may be declared in such part of Wales and of such size as the National Assembly considers necessary to prevent the spread of disease.

4

A wild animal infected zone must remain in effect until—

a

such date as may be stated in the declaration; or

b

it is removed by further declaration of the National Assembly.

5

Any premises which are partly inside and partly outside a wild animal infected zone are deemed to be wholly inside that zone.

6

Any wild animal infected zone is an infected area for the purposes of the Act.
